Who is Master of International Law?
An international lawyer provides legal assistance in international relations, including during disputes in court.These types of disputes include international business, trade, or criminal issues.
What are international lawyer’s tasks?
The main tasks of the Master of International Law are: development of new directions and solutions for clients' activities, opening of non-resident bank accounts, opening of non-resident companies, writing legal opinions, preparing analytical materials, commercial proposals, expert opinions and comments, conducting business correspondence with international lawyers, bankers and partners, contractual work.
